Practical Dojo Projects (Paperback)
暫譯: 實用的 Dojo 專案 (平裝本)
Frank Zammetti
- 出版商: Apress
- 出版日期: 2008-09-24
- 售價: $1,810
- 貴賓價: 9.5 折 $1,720
- 語言: 英文
- 頁數: 500
- 裝訂: Paperback
- ISBN: 1430210664
- ISBN-13: 9781430210665
海外代購書籍(需單獨結帳)
相關主題
商品描述
The era of professional JavaScript development has arrived! Gone are the days when writing all the client–side code for your applications by hand yourself was the norm. Gone are the days when scrounging around the Internet to find a snippet of code to do something you need could lead to either decent code or utter garbage that you’d surely regret using later.
No, writing high–quality JavaScript these days is a whole lot easier with the advent of top–notch libraries that save you time and effort, and one that stands out from most others is Dojo.
Dojo is a library like few others: written by some of the best JavaScript coders around today, providing nearly everything you’ll need to write modern Rich Internet Applications, all in one place. From Ajax to widgets, to client–side persistence and language extensions, and many points in between, Dojo has it all.
In Practical Dojo Projects, you’ll learn all about what Dojo has to offer. You’ll see it in action in the form of five fully functional applications, which include
- A contact manager for storing info for all the important people in your life
- A code cabinet: a place to store, index, and get code snippets from
- A stock tracker to keep track of your stock portfolio
- A message forum for open discussions on topics you define
- Even a fun little game!
By the time you’ve finished reading, you’ll have a firm grasp on what Dojo is all about, and you’ll have the preparation you need to begin to use it yourself in your own projects. See you inside!
What you’ll learn
- Uncover the fundamentals of Dojo, its core, Dojo Widgets, and DojoX.
- Build sophisticated JavaScript/Ajax–based applications starting with a Dojo contact manager.
- Create a code cabinet, a place to store snippets of code for later reuse using Dojo and Dojo Offline (based on Google Gears).
- See how to build an interactive and fun came application using Dojo.
- Build a stock watcher application, which allows you to enter ticker symbols and will show you real–time updates using some available web service; show net gain/loss over various time periods (hourly/daily/weekly/monthly/yearly) with various charts and graphs.
- Take Dojo into social networking by building a messaging forums application.
Who is this book for
Web application developers, senior projects leads, and application architects
About the Apress Practical Series
The Practical series from Apress is your best choice for getting the job done, period. From professional to expert, this series lets you apply project–motivated templates (or frameworks) step by step in a very direct, practical, and efficient manner toward current real–world projects that may be sitting on your desk. So whatever your career goal, Apress can be your trusted guide to take you where you want to go on your IT career empowerment path.
商品描述(中文翻譯)
專業 JavaScript 開發的時代已經來臨!過去手動編寫應用程式的所有客戶端代碼的日子已經一去不復返。過去在網路上四處搜尋代碼片段以完成某些需求的日子也已經結束,這樣的搜尋可能會導致找到不錯的代碼或是完全不堪的垃圾代碼,使用後肯定會後悔。
如今,隨著頂尖庫的出現,撰寫高品質的 JavaScript 變得輕鬆多了,這些庫能夠節省你的時間和精力,而其中最突出的就是 Dojo。
Dojo 是一個獨特的庫:由當今一些最優秀的 JavaScript 程式設計師編寫,提供幾乎所有你需要的功能來撰寫現代的豐富網路應用程式,所有功能都集中在一個地方。從 Ajax 到小工具,再到客戶端持久性和語言擴展,以及許多其他功能,Dojo 一應俱全。
在《實用 Dojo 專案》中,你將學習到 Dojo 所提供的一切。你將看到五個完全功能的應用程式,這些應用程式包括:
- 一個聯絡人管理器,用於儲存你生活中所有重要人物的資訊
- 一個代碼櫃:用於儲存、索引和獲取代碼片段的地方
- 一個股票追蹤器,用於追蹤你的股票投資組合
- 一個消息論壇,用於開放討論你定義的主題
- 甚至還有一個有趣的小遊戲!
當你讀完這本書時,你將對 Dojo 有深入的了解,並且具備開始在自己的專案中使用它的準備。期待在書中見到你!
### 你將學到什麼
- 探索 Dojo 的基本原理、核心、Dojo Widgets 和 DojoX。
- 從 Dojo 聯絡人管理器開始,構建複雜的 JavaScript/Ajax 應用程式。
- 創建一個代碼櫃,使用 Dojo 和 Dojo Offline(基於 Google Gears)儲存代碼片段以便日後重用。
- 了解如何使用 Dojo 構建一個互動且有趣的遊戲應用程式。
- 構建一個股票監控應用程式,允許你輸入股票代碼,並使用一些可用的網路服務顯示即時更新;顯示各種時間段(每小時/每日/每週/每月/每年)的淨增益/損失,並提供各種圖表和圖形。
- 通過構建一個消息論壇應用程式,將 Dojo 帶入社交網路。
### 本書適合誰
網頁應用程式開發人員、高級專案負責人和應用程式架構師
### 關於 Apress 實用系列
Apress 的實用系列是你完成工作的最佳選擇,無論是專業還是專家,這個系列讓你能夠以非常直接、實用和高效的方式,逐步應用專案驅動的模板(或框架)來處理當前可能擺在你桌上的現實專案。因此,無論你的職業目標是什麼,Apress 都可以成為你值得信賴的指導,帶你走上 IT 職業發展的道路。